ADHD medications fall into two main categories: stimulants and non-stimulants. So stimulant medications, such as methylphenidate (Ritalin) and amphetamine (Adderall), are the most commonly prescribed ADHD medications. These medications work by increasing the levels of certain neurotransmitters in the brain, such as dopamine and norepinephrine, which can improve focus and reduce impulsivity.
Non-stimulant medications, such as atomoxetine (Strattera) and guanfacine (Intuniv), work differently than stimulants. How Different Tests Detect ADHD Medications
| Test Type | Typical Detection Window | What It Looks For | Common Detection Limits |
|---|---|---|---|
| Urine | 1–4 days (methylphenidate), 1–3 days (amphetamine) | Metabolites of stimulants; atomoxetine metabolites | 200–300 ng/mL for stimulants; 500–700 ng/mL for atomoxetine |
| Blood | 12–48 hours | Parent drug levels | 10–20 ng/mL for methylphenidate; 5–10 ng/mL for atomoxetine |
| Saliva | 12–24 hours | Parent drug | 10–20 ng/mL |
| Hair | 90–120 days | Drug incorporated into hair shaft | 0.5–5 pg/mg |
Because stimulants are metabolized rapidly, a single dose may only be detectable for a day or two in urine. Because of that, non‑stimulants, on the other hand, have a longer half‑life and can show up for several days even after the last dose. Laboratories will typically flag any detected level above the minimum threshold and then run a confirmatory assay (usually GC‑MS or LC‑MS/MS) to rule out false positives Less friction, more output..
Employer Policies and Legal Protections
-
Prescribed‑Medication Exceptions
Many employers, especially those with “zero‑tolerance” policies, allow a prescription to be disclosed as a legitimate reason for a positive result. A written note from a licensed prescriber that lists the medication name, dosage, and indication is usually sufficient It's one of those things that adds up.. -
American Disabilities Act (ADA) Considerations
Under the ADA, an employee using a prescribed ADHD medication cannot be discriminated against solely on the basis of a positive drug test, provided the medication is part of a legitimate medical treatment plan. Employers are required to provide reasonable accommodations, which may include flexible work schedules or a modified testing schedule. -
“Reasonable Accommodation” vs. “Medical Exemptions”
The distinction matters: a reasonable accommodation is a change in the testing procedure (e.g., testing after medication intake), whereas a medical exemption is a blanket waiver of testing. Employers typically favor accommodations because they preserve safety and compliance while respecting medical needs Worth keeping that in mind.. -
Sports and Anti‑Doping Rules
While most ADHD stimulants are prohibited substances in competitive sports, non‑stimulants like atomoxetine are generally exempt. Athletes must obtain a Therapeutic Use Exemption (TUE) and submit a prescription and medical justification to the governing body. Failure to do so can lead to sanctions.
